Abstract

A number of universities have established Career Development Centers (CDC) or career development units, designed to assist students in understanding career-related materials and making informed career decisions. In reality, not everyone has equal opportunities to secure a good and promising job. Therefore, it is not surprising that many people flock to find employment. Wiralodra University faces challenges due to the absence of CDC (Career Development Center) services, making it difficult for students to obtain the advice and materials needed to advance their professions. The Career Development Center (CDC) plays a crucial role in student development, primarily focusing on enhancing career readiness. CDC not only provides efficient, up-to-date job vacancy information but also aims to support the career development of students and alumni through counseling services, alumni experience sharing, and training to prepare them for the challenges of the job market. Evaluations conducted by CDC, based on criteria tailored to specific needs, have shown that this program has made a significant impact. Students involved with the CDC experience increased career readiness, quick access to relevant information, and build strong relationships with industries, all contributing to the comprehensive development of students in achieving their career goals
